CARNER v. CITY OF BUFFALO


33 A.D.2d 1098 (1970)

Frederick C. Carner et al., on Behalf of Themselves and All Other Professional Fire Fighters Similarly Situated and Employed by The City of Buffalo, Respondents, v. City of Buffalo,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Fourth Department.

February 12, 1970


Order unanimously modified by deleting all decretal paragraphs except the first paragraph denying defendant's motion to dismiss the complaint, and as so modified affirmed, without costs.
